Other Agriculture is the 267th most popular major in the country with 602 degrees awarded in 2020-2021. In 2019-2020, other agriculture gra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$41,859 and had an average of $23,034 in loans still to pay off.
Across Alabama, there were 9 other agriculture gra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the doctor’s degree level specifically, there were 2 other agriculture graduates with average earnings and debt of $81,366 and $0 respectively.
